Event Details
Date: 05 January 2026
Time: 11 AM
City: Penfield, NY
Country: United States
Location: Penfield Public Library, 1985 Baird Rd
Date: 05 January 2026
Time: 11 AM
City: Penfield, NY
Country: United States
Location: Penfield Public Library, 1985 Baird Rd